About The Position

Our Property Tax Director will manage a team of property tax compliance professionals at the Lead Vice President, Vice President, Manager, Senior Associate, and Analyst levels who are responsible for the preparation and filing of state and local property tax returns, reviewing assessment notices, and procuring, approving and processing property tax bills.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in a business-related field or equivalent years of property tax related experience
  • Minimum 15 years of relevant property tax compliance experience, including leasing property tax compliance experience
  • Familiarity with property tax compliance software programs, with an emphasis on PowerPlan software/system experience and familiarity
  • In-depth knowledge of property tax filing requirements and procedures of various state and local jurisdictions
  • Excellent project management and presentation skills, including superior verbal and written communication skills
  • Extensive experience in the use of Microsoft Excel
  • Previous experience leading a team of professionals
  • Excellent relationship management skills and an entrepreneurial spirit

Responsibilities

  • Establishing operational objectives and work plans/work flows to ensure compliance functions that occur over the tax year calendar are completed on a timely basis
  • Directing and overseeing team leaders to ensure the timely delivery of client service
  • Interfacing with client contacts and communicating progress of deliverables
  • Mentoring staff on processes, analyses, reports, and deliverables
  • Developing, maintaining, and assessing the overall and individual goals of the compliance team members
  • Ensuring property tax team and its members provide best-in-class customer service to our clients
